About Phantom Power Supply
Phantom power supply is an essential tool in the world of audio production, providing the necessary voltage to condenser microphones and other audio equipment that requires external power for operation. Typically delivered through microphone cables, phantom power enables these devices to function optimally, ensuring high-quality sound capture by activating their internal electronics. This technology is indispensable in both studio recordings and live sound settings, where the clarity and detail of audio are paramount.
The variety of phantom power supplies available caters to different needs and setups. From single-channel units designed for individual microphones to multi-channel systems capable of powering several devices simultaneously, there's a solution for every scale of operation. Portable options are also available for field recordings or on-location shoots, providing flexibility and convenience for audio professionals and enthusiasts alike.
The design principles behind phantom power supplies focus on reliability, consistency, and safety. These units are engineered to deliver a steady voltage, typically 48 volts, ensuring that microphones and other equipment receive the exact power they need for optimal performance. Additionally, built-in protection circuits safeguard against electrical surges and short circuits, protecting both the microphones and the power supply itself. Features such as LED indicators for power status and low-noise design are common, enhancing the user experience and audio quality.
